New journalism, Journalism, LiteratureAbstract
The proposal of the present text on literature and journalism: as complementary and not exculpatory areas, aim at to discourse on the approach between both the sorts, being given emphasis when journalistic making. At a first moment, the necessity appears of a brief historical panel, contexting the world of the journalism that, in its origins, counted on the active participation of writers in periodical writings. New journalism appears in this perspective as the first experience of disruption admitted to the traditional squeak of the press, either for the indignation of the conservationism; either for the irreverence in relation to the basic rules of the journalism, as objec-tiving and to moving away of the facts.
